Manufacturers often coat screws with zinc, chrome, or other anti-corrosive layers. This protects the fastener in harsh environments—think coastal regions where salty air corrodes metal quickly. For long-term projects, such longevity isn’t just a bonus; it’s a must.
Unlike some screws limited to thin metals, 3 point self drilling screws handle a broad thickness range and materials—from galvanized steel to layered wood composites. This versatility reduces the need for multiple screw types in one project.
Even though these screws might come with a slight premium upfront, the time saved on installation (no pilot holes = faster work) offsets labor costs—especially important in regions where skilled labor is at a premium.
The precise tip reduces slippage and “walk-off” during installation, which cuts down on worker mistakes and tool damage. This also boosts safety, a subtle but often overlooked aspect.
As factories become smarter, these screws work well with power tools and automated screw-driving robots, accelerating mass production.
|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Material | High-grade carbon steel, zinc plated |
| Diameter | #10 (4.8mm) |
| Length | 30mm – 100mm (varies) |
| Tip Design | 3 point self-drilling with tri-cut flutes |
| Head Type | Hex washer / Pan head |
| Drive Type | Phillips / Pozidriv / Torx (varies) |
| Corrosion Rating | ASTM B117 salt spray tested to 96 hours |

They’re not silver bullets. Sometimes, these screws struggle with exceptionally thick steel or extremely hard alloys where pre-drilling is unavoidable. Also, improper installation can cause thread stripping or weak seals.
Experts recommend combining good tool maintenance with selecting screws optimized for the materials used—no one-size-fits-all here. Training laborers with hands-on demos also helps mitigate errors.
